As of April 9, 2026, no recent earnings data is available for Special Opportunities Fund Inc. 2.75% Convertible Preferred Stock Series C (SPE^C), as no quarterly earnings release tied to the most recently ended fiscal quarter has been published to date. SPE^C is a convertible preferred security issued by the closed-end fund focused on special situation and alternative credit investments, with features that combine a fixed 2.75% annual coupon with the option to convert shares to the issuer’s comm

Management Commentary

No formal management commentary tied to a quarterly earnings release for SPE^C has been issued in recent weeks, given the absence of a published earnings report. However, senior leadership from Special Opportunities Fund Inc. shared public remarks earlier this month at a closed-end fund industry conference, addressing the firm’s broader portfolio strategy that supports all of its outstanding share classes, including SPE^C. Management noted that recent bouts of market volatility could create potential opportunities to acquire discounted assets in niche credit and distressed corporate sectors, though they emphasized that the firm would maintain conservative leverage levels to protect preferred shareholder priorities. Leadership also reiterated that the firm’s capital allocation framework prioritizes meeting all preferred dividend obligations before any distributions to common shareholders, consistent with the terms outlined in SPE^C’s original prospectus. No specific updates related to SPE^C’s conversion terms, call schedules, or coupon rates were shared during the public remarks. Forward Guidance

No formal quarterly forward guidance tied to an earnings release has been issued for SPE^C as of the current date. The firm’s standing long-term guidance, which remains in effect, states that it intends to maintain consistent preferred dividend payouts across all outstanding preferred share classes, barring unforeseen material adverse impacts to its core portfolio’s net asset value. Analysts who cover the issuer note that SPE^C’s conversion value would likely fluctuate in the upcoming months in line with moves in the firm’s common stock price, as well as shifts in prevailing interest rates, which typically impact the fixed income component of preferred security valuations. The firm has not announced any proposals to adjust the conversion ratio, call price, or other core terms of SPE^C, and any such changes would require formal approval from a majority of outstanding preferred shareholders per regulatory requirements. Market Reaction

In the absence of a recent earnings release, there has been no targeted post-earnings market reaction for SPE^C in recent sessions. The security has traded in a narrow range consistent with peer convertible preferred securities issued by closed-end alternative asset funds, with no unusual volume spikes that would signal unanticipated material news related to SPE^C. Limited analyst coverage of the security notes that the 2.75% coupon may be less attractive relative to newer preferred issues with higher coupons in the current interest rate environment, though the embedded conversion option offers potential upside if the firm’s common stock outperforms broad market expectations. Market data shows that institutional ownership of SPE^C has remained stable in recent months, with no large reported changes in position sizes among the security’s top holders.
